Certificates, fees & processing
| Record | Fee | Processing |
|---|---|---|
| Birth Certificate | $20.00 | 12–13 weeksConnecticut estimate |
| Death Certificate | $20.00 | 12–13 weeksConnecticut estimate |
| Marriage Certificate | $20.00 | 12–13 weeksConnecticut estimate |
Processing times are set at state level — county offices do not publish their own — and are estimates that vary with demand.
The Windsor Office of the Town Clerk’s office or registry of vital records, offers a wide range of crucial services. These offices play a vital role in the protection and provision of essential documents such as birth certificates, death certificates, and marriage certificates . In addition to maintaining these primary records, they are responsible for managing and issuing copies of birth, marriage, and death records that occurred within the Township of Windsor. Alongside record maintenance, this office provides valuable services like issuing certified copies of documents, overseeing the registration of domestic partnerships, and offering assistance to rectify any errors detected in vital records. Through these comprehensive services, the vital records office ensures the accuracy, accessibility, and integrity of vital records for the benefit of the community.
